Introduction to Split System Air Conditioning

Split system air conditioning is very popular in Australia, with millions used in homes. It has two main parts: an outdoor unit and one or more indoor units. These are often called wall-mounted AC units.

This setup makes installation easy and avoids the need for complex ductwork. It’s great for cooling specific areas well.

These units work well in small spaces like single bedrooms or apartments up to 60 square meters. For bigger needs, multi-split systems can link several indoor units to one outdoor compressor. This is perfect for small homes.

Split system air conditioning has gotten better with inverter technologies. This makes mini-split AC models about 30% more efficient than usual ones. Brands like Mitsubishi Electric, Fujitsu, and Daikin lead the market with various options for different climates.

Professional installation costs range from $650 to $850, plus GST. The cost for the indoor unit starts around $900.

How Split System Air Conditioning Works

It’s important to know how split system air conditioning works. These systems have two main parts that work together to keep your space cool. They are designed to control the temperature effectively.

Components of a Split System

A split system air conditioner has an outdoor and an indoor unit. The outdoor unit has the compressor and condenser. The indoor unit has the evaporator coil and fan.

This setup allows for efficient heat exchange. It makes wall-mounted AC units great for different room sizes. For example, a 2.5kWh system is good for spaces up to 20m2. Larger areas might need systems rated 7kWh or more.

Operation of Split Systems

Split systems work on the principle of heat exchange. In cooling mode, the indoor unit pulls heat from the room. It then sends this heat to the refrigerant in the system.

The outdoor unit then releases this heat, making the room cooler. In heating mode, the process is reversed. This shows how versatile these units are.

The use of inverter technology improves performance. It adjusts the compressor speed to meet cooling needs. This provides consistent temperatures and saves energy over time. For more on energy savings, check out this resource.

Comparing Costs: Split System vs Ducted Systems

Homeowners need to know the costs of air conditioning systems. Looking at upfront costs, running costs, and energy use helps decide between split systems and ducted systems.

Upfront Installation Costs

Split system air conditioners are cheaper upfront than ducted systems. They don’t need big ductwork, saving money. A split system costs between $600 and $2,800, with installation adding $600 to $800.

Ducted air conditioning systems cost more, starting at about $9,000. This shows a bigger upfront investment.

Running Costs and Energy Consumption

Split systems are more energy-efficient in smaller spaces. A 2.5-kilowatt split system uses about 511 kWh a year, costing around $110. A 5-kilowatt unit costs about $180 annually, and a 6-kilowatt model costs around $280.

Ducted systems are better for bigger spaces but can be more expensive. They have higher costs per room, from $2.45 to $3.45 for cooling. Knowing these costs helps homeowners choose wisely based on their budget and energy use.

The Role of Inverter Technology in Efficiency

Inverter technology is a big step forward in air conditioning, especially in split systems. It lets air conditioners adjust their power to fit the cooling or heating needs of a room. This is different from old models that just turn on and off.

This adjustment means better temperature control and saves energy. It’s a key reason why inverter systems are more efficient.

What is Inverter Air Conditioning?

Inverter air conditioning uses new tech to control the compressor speed. This ensures the system works best for the current needs in the room. Unlike old air conditioners, which waste energy by turning on and off too much.

Inverters keep the air cool or warm steadily. This not only saves energy but also makes the air feel more comfortable. Switching to inverter models can cut energy costs by up to 40%.

Maintenance Tips for Optimal Performance

To get the most out of split system air conditioners, regular maintenance is key. A good upkeep routine boosts performance and saves on energy costs.

Regular Check-ups and Servicing

Regular check-ups are crucial for your air conditioner to work its best. It’s wise to get a professional to service it at least once a year. This includes checking the motor, cleaning the ducts, and swapping out old filters.

Regular checks can spot problems early. This means your unit will last longer and use less energy.

Importance of Cleaning Filters

Cleaning your filters every month, or every two months if you use it a lot, is essential. Dirty filters block airflow, making your system work harder and use more energy. If you live in a dusty or windy area, you might need to change filters more often.

Keeping your filters clean keeps the air in your home fresh. It also makes your cooling system more effective.

Climate Considerations for Air Conditioning Systems

When picking an air conditioning system, knowing the local climate is key. In Australia, the weather affects how much energy a system uses. For example, places like Brisbane need split systems that cool well and use less energy.

How Climate Affects Energy Consumption

The right air conditioning unit must fit the local climate. In hot areas, a split system’s energy use drops if it’s the right size. This avoids wasting energy by choosing the wrong size.

Getting the size right, about 0.15 kW per square meter, helps a lot. It makes sure the unit works well without using too much power.
